Transaction e0872bf6951aa4915129ce840074a91cfc0f629b91f110ad52539411a385f6eb
1 Input
1 Output
-
e0872bf6951aa4915129ce840074a91cfc0f629b91f110ad52539411a385f6eb:0
- value
- 13789
- script pubkey
- OP_0 OP_PUSHBYTES_20 707f53e9c840359de9d52206736d5e16ae8aef03
- address
- bc1qwpl486wggq6em6w4ygr8xm27z6hg4mcrwg6gd9